İsrail’in Gazze’ye Hava Saldırısı: Hamas Lideri Öldü

In a recent escalation, an Israeli airstrike in Gaza City has killed the new head of Hamas’s military wing along with at least two other individuals. The attack occurred despite an existing ceasefire agreement between Israel and Hamas, adding tension to the already fragile situation in the region. Local sources report considerable damage in the area and a rising fear of renewed hostilities. Observers note that this strike could have significant implications for peace negotiations and regional stability.

The targeted airstrike appears to be a part of ongoing efforts by Israel to eliminate key figures within Hamas, an organization considered a terrorist group by several countries, including Israel and the United States. Hamas, on the other hand, controls the Gaza Strip and has been in conflict with Israel for several years. This targeted killing underlines the complexities of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ict, which sees periods of relative calm disrupted by sudden violence.

International reactions have been mixed. Some countries have called for restraint and adherence to ceasefire agreements, while others have reiterated their stance supporting Israel’s right to self-defense. The impact of the strike is likely to be felt in diplomatic circles, where calls for renewed peace talks may gain momentum amid the heightened tensions.

Continued surveillance and analysis by global powers and international organizations are expected as both sides reassess their positions in light of the recent events. The situation remains volatile, with future developments hinging heavily on diplomatic engagements and ground realities in the conflicted region.
